NAME
cdigit - Collection of check digit algorithms implemented in JavaScript
SYNOPSIS
const cdigit = require('cdigit');
console.log(cdigit.luhn.compute('1234'));
console.log(cdigit.luhn.generate('1234'));
console.log(cdigit.luhn.validate('12344'));
SUPPORTED ALGORITHMS
Algorithm | cdigit name | Input string | Check character(s) |
---|
Luhn | luhn | Numeric (0-9) | 1 digit (0-9) |
Verhoeff | verhoeff | Numeric (0-9) | 1 digit (0-9)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 11-2 | mod11_2 | Numeric (0-9) | 1 digit or 'X' (0-9X)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 37-2 | mod37_2 | Alphanumeric (0-9A-Z) | 1 digit, letter, or '*' (0-9A-Z*)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 97-10 | mod97_10 | Numeric (0-9) | 2 digits (0-9)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 661-26 | mod661_26 | Alphabetic (A-Z) | 2 letters (A-Z)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 1271-36 | mod1271_36 | Alphanumeric (0-9A-Z) | 2 digits or letters (0-9A-Z)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 11-10 | mod11_10 | Numeric (0-9) | 1 digit (0-9)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 27-26 | mod27_26 | Alphabetic (A-Z) | 1 letter (A-Z) |
ISO/IEC 7064, MOD 37-36 | mod37_36 | Alphanumeric (0-9A-Z) | 1 digit or letter (0-9A-Z) |
USAGE
Load cdigit
and access to an algorithm object by cdigit.name as listed in
SUPPORTED ALGORITHMS section.
const cdigit = require('cdigit');
const algo = cdigit.mod97_10;
Algorithm objects implement the following methods.
validate(num: string): boolean
Check if a given string is valid in accordance with the algorithm. The argument
must include check digit(s) as well as the source number.
console.log(cdigit.mod97_10.validate('123482'));
generate(num: string): string
Generate a valid number string from a given source number. The generated string
includes the check digit(s) computed and placed in accordance with the
algorithm.
console.log(cdigit.mod97_10.generate('1234'));
compute(num: string): string
Generate check digit(s) from a given source number. This returns the check
digit(s) only.
console.log(cdigit.mod97_10.compute('1234'));
